WebJan 11, 2024 · Visas can be very difficult to apply for, and may require heaps of documents like bank statements, proof address, proof of identity, proof of where you’ll be staying, letters of invitation, proof of time that will be spent in the country you’ll visit, and more. Other visas are easy to apply for and may require simply filling out a form online. WebApr 22, 2024 · J-1 nonimmigrants are therefore sponsored by an exchange program that is designated as such by the U.S. Department of State. These programs are designed to promote the interchange of persons, knowledge, and skills, in the fields of education, arts, and science. WebHow to Apply Step 1 Complete the Nonimmigrant Visa Electronic Application (DS-160) form. Step 2 Pay the visa application fee. Step 3 Schedule your appointment on this web page. You need the following three pieces of information in order to schedule your appointment: Your passport number. The receipt number from your Visa Fee receipt.
